Data accessible over the internet and not stored on a local hard drive is in the cloud. Cloud services allow for files to be stored on remote servers and accessed from any device.

Cloud storage services, like Microsoft's OneDrive and Goo-gle Drive, provide the ability to store files on remote servers which can be accessed from any device with an internet connection. The digital data, including documents, photos, and videos, is encoded into binary ones and zeros, allowing easy sharing and collaboration without the need for physical storage devices such as external hard drives.
